Cranberry Pear Crumble


 
 
Ingredients:
6 pears cored or 2 cans pear halves in 100% juice cut into 1 inch pieces
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on lemon juice
2 Tbls.  Cranberry Pear Balsamic Vinegar
1 cup  fresh or frozen cranberries
1 ½ cups rolled oats
1 ¼ cup walnuts
¼ cup honey
¼ cup plus 2 Tbls. Butter Olive Oil
2 Tablespoons extra liquid pear juice or water
Directions:
Preheat oven to 350.  Toss pear pieces and cranberries with lemon juice, additional liquid and balsamic.   Place fruit in ungreased 2 quart casserole dish (or 9 inch deep dish pie plate).  Put 1 cup walnuts and ½ cup oats in food processor and grind into a fine powder.  In small bowl stir together ground walnuts, ground oats, remaining rolled oats, honey, olive oil and cinnamon.  Add remaining walnut pieces and stir until well combined.  Sprinkle evenly over fruit.  Bake at 350 degrees for 25 to 35 minutes.
